Brit Asia Music Awards winners announced
This was the second successful year of the Brit Asia Music Awards that took place at London’s Hammersmith Apollo. The event was hosted by Hardeep Kohli, British writer and radio and television presenter.
The stage was graced by popular music artists with entertaining performances and the show was closed with a remarkable finale performance by Jazzy B who was joined by his collaborating partner Sukshinder Shinda.
Preeya Kalidas was voted the best female act and Garry Sandhu was voted the best male act, best newcomer at Brit Asia Music Awards. Jazz B and the band was the best band where as Lifetime achievement award was awarded to Bhujhangy Group. The event will be telecast on Brit Asia TV later this year.

'Double Treat for Zindagi Na Milegee Dobaraa at NDTV awards
NDTV Indian of the Year Award was a star studded ceremony held at Taj Palace Hotel in Delhi. This award honours individuals who helped build brand India through their outstanding contributions.
It was ‘Zindagi Na Milegee Dobaraa’ which bagged two awards. Music composer Shankar-Ehsaan-Loy was awarded as ‘Entertainer of the Year (Music)’for their compositions in Zindagi Na Milegi Dobara and the team of ‘Zindagi Na Milegee Dobaraa’ received award for being the most entertaining movie of the year.
The other extraordinary Indians who were awarded NDTV Indian of The Year’ who have shown excellence in their respective fields like business, sports, entertainment and have done the nation proud were Anna Hazare, Arvind Kejriwal, Dev Anand,Rahul Dravid, NR Narayana Murthy, Mr. Nandan Nilekani, among others.

Close to 40,000 Metallica fans made sure they did not miss any of the head-banging metal music by the American heavy metal group. The opening act was by Delhi-Based metal band Guillotine, which was chosen to open for Metallica’s F1 gig in India through 'Taking Pole Position' competition which was held by Talenthouse India in association with MTV and VH1. The band was followed by the Bangalore band Inner Sanctum, followed by the Scottish band Biffy Clyro.
Finally Metallica opened its account to dish out solid heavy metal for two hours straight thereafter. Energy was high and spirits skyrcoketed crazily. Metallica mania reached its peak as streets in Bengaluru were blasting the band’s songs on loudspeakers. The numbers included ‘Nothing Else Matters’, ‘Fade to Black’, ‘For Whom the Bell Tolls’, ‘Cyanide’ and ‘Seek and Destroy’, a song with which they ended their musical feast.The numbers included ‘Nothing Else Matters’, ‘Fade to Black’, ‘For Whom the Bell Tolls’, ‘Cyanide’ and ‘Seek and Destroy’, a song with which they ended their musical feast. The frenzied crowd was an elctic mix, coming from distant places like Kolkata, Delhi, Kochi and Hyderabad, apart from the Bengaluru fans.. Swarathma, a socially conscious, contemporary folk-fusion band, brought a grin on the faces of several children with a concert at National Association for the Blind campus. The concert was attended by over a hundred students from schools for the visually challenged in and around Bangalore. Swarathma, the Bangalore-based band enthralled the audience with a fusion of versatile beats and meaningful lyrics. Swarathma performs free concerts for those who do not have access to live music, using music to raise social consciousness and bring hope to underprivileged people in India, including the children at a school for the blind. The concert was as a part of its global “Go Forth” engagement program, Levi’s® has collaborated with Swarathma to help their efforts. The “Go Forth” campaign celebrates modern day pioneers around the world and provides people the opportunity to support meaningful cause
